A well-established company in Saffron Walden is seeking a Facilities & Maintenance Co-ordinator to oversee building maintenance, contractor management, and IT support.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ience in facilities management and a basic understanding of IT.
Responsibilities include:
- Managing the maintenance of the premises
- Supporting health and safety processes
- Ensuring smooth operations
This role requires a proactive individual who can operate independently and manage contractors effectively.
